Food it!
Basic information
- Address
Centro Comercial Plenilunio Parque Empresarial Las Mercedes Ctra. Barcelona Km. 11
28022 Madrid
Spain- Phone
- 917475838
- website
- www.ribs.es
- Type of cuisine
- Tejana Americana
- Help us improve Click here if you find an error in this restaurant
Error information 
